)]}'
{"deployment/ironic/ironic-inspector-container-puppet.yaml":[{"author":{"_account_id":24245,"name":"Harald Jensås","email":"hjensas@redhat.com","username":"harald.jensas"},"change_message_id":"43ef0aa33e258ad05c45c2cc54706afd2e4fa469","unresolved":false,"context_lines":[{"line_number":179,"context_line":"        \u0027137 ironic-inspector\u0027:"},{"line_number":180,"context_line":"          dport:"},{"line_number":181,"context_line":"            - 5050"},{"line_number":182,"context_line":"        \u0027137 ironic-inspector dhcp input\u0027:"},{"line_number":183,"context_line":"          iniface: {get_param: IronicInspectorInterface}"},{"line_number":184,"context_line":"          proto: \u0027udp\u0027"},{"line_number":185,"context_line":"          chain: \u0027INPUT\u0027"},{"line_number":186,"context_line":"          dport: 67"},{"line_number":187,"context_line":"        \u0027137 ironic-inspector dhcp output\u0027:"},{"line_number":188,"context_line":"          proto: \u0027udp\u0027"},{"line_number":189,"context_line":"          chain: \u0027OUTPUT\u0027"},{"line_number":190,"context_line":"          dport: 68"},{"line_number":191,"context_line":"      monitoring_subscription: {get_param: MonitoringSubscriptionIronicInspector}"},{"line_number":192,"context_line":"      config_settings:"},{"line_number":193,"context_line":"        map_merge:"}],"source_content_type":"text/x-yaml","patch_set":21,"id":"3fa7e38b_3ac0a250","line":190,"range":{"start_line":182,"start_character":0,"end_line":190,"end_character":19},"updated":"2019-09-21 15:17:00.000000000","message":"Not a problem specific to this change. But, we should have support for setting firewall rules based on IP version. The DHCP ports used for IPv4 is 67 (client) and 68 (server). On IPv6 DHCPv6 uses ports 546 (clients) and 547 (servers).\n\nI put some comments on https://review.opendev.org/680485 which is already merged. I think this needs fixing?","commit_id":"c960420c5545968a871f9b9293039cc4c12e241f"},{"author":{"_account_id":24245,"name":"Harald Jensås","email":"hjensas@redhat.com","username":"harald.jensas"},"change_message_id":"1d7814dd0b6aa9862203c5f518f631d1cc4b93c7","unresolved":false,"context_lines":[{"line_number":175,"context_line":"    description: Role data for the Ironic Inspector role."},{"line_number":176,"context_line":"    value:"},{"line_number":177,"context_line":"      service_name: ironic_inspector"},{"line_number":178,"context_line":"      firewall_rules:"},{"line_number":179,"context_line":"        \u0027137 ironic-inspector\u0027:"},{"line_number":180,"context_line":"          dport:"},{"line_number":181,"context_line":"            - 5050"},{"line_number":182,"context_line":"        \u0027137 ironic-inspector dhcp input\u0027:"},{"line_number":183,"context_line":"          iniface: {get_param: IronicInspectorInterface}"},{"line_number":184,"context_line":"          proto: \u0027udp\u0027"},{"line_number":185,"context_line":"          chain: \u0027INPUT\u0027"},{"line_number":186,"context_line":"          dport: 67"},{"line_number":187,"context_line":"        \u0027137 ironic-inspector dhcp output\u0027:"},{"line_number":188,"context_line":"          proto: \u0027udp\u0027"},{"line_number":189,"context_line":"          chain: \u0027OUTPUT\u0027"},{"line_number":190,"context_line":"          dport: 68"},{"line_number":191,"context_line":"      monitoring_subscription: {get_param: MonitoringSubscriptionIronicInspector}"},{"line_number":192,"context_line":"      config_settings:"},{"line_number":193,"context_line":"        map_merge:"}],"source_content_type":"text/x-yaml","patch_set":23,"id":"3fa7e38b_4f601ed0","line":190,"range":{"start_line":178,"start_character":0,"end_line":190,"end_character":19},"updated":"2019-10-09 20:30:51.000000000","message":"This need an update to match:\nhttps://review.opendev.org/684385","commit_id":"c78deb7d98cfb958bc8e76f590a18f65dfabb591"}],"deployment/neutron/neutron-dhcp-container-puppet.yaml":[{"author":{"_account_id":24245,"name":"Harald Jensås","email":"hjensas@redhat.com","username":"harald.jensas"},"change_message_id":"1d7814dd0b6aa9862203c5f518f631d1cc4b93c7","unresolved":false,"context_lines":[{"line_number":180,"context_line":"    description: Role data for the Neutron DHCP role."},{"line_number":181,"context_line":"    value:"},{"line_number":182,"context_line":"      service_name: neutron_dhcp"},{"line_number":183,"context_line":"      firewall_rules:"},{"line_number":184,"context_line":"        \u0027115 neutron dhcp input\u0027:"},{"line_number":185,"context_line":"          proto: \u0027udp\u0027"},{"line_number":186,"context_line":"          dport: 67"},{"line_number":187,"context_line":"        \u0027116 neutron dhcp output\u0027:"},{"line_number":188,"context_line":"          proto: \u0027udp\u0027"},{"line_number":189,"context_line":"          chain: \u0027OUTPUT\u0027"},{"line_number":190,"context_line":"          dport: 68"},{"line_number":191,"context_line":"      monitoring_subscription: {get_param: MonitoringSubscriptionNeutronDhcp}"},{"line_number":192,"context_line":"      config_settings:"},{"line_number":193,"context_line":"        map_merge:"}],"source_content_type":"text/x-yaml","patch_set":23,"id":"3fa7e38b_2fa122f9","line":190,"range":{"start_line":183,"start_character":0,"end_line":190,"end_character":19},"updated":"2019-10-09 20:30:51.000000000","message":"This need an update to match:\nhttps://review.opendev.org/684385","commit_id":"c78deb7d98cfb958bc8e76f590a18f65dfabb591"}],"deployment/neutron/neutron-ovs-dpdk-agent-container-puppet.yaml":[{"author":{"_account_id":14985,"name":"Alex Schultz","email":"aschultz@next-development.com","username":"mwhahaha"},"change_message_id":"a2af82e7e4f54a192df04ec383b249b6166a51c3","unresolved":false,"context_lines":[{"line_number":118,"context_line":"          - map_replace:"},{"line_number":119,"context_line":"            - get_attr: [NeutronOvsAgent, role_data, config_settings]"},{"line_number":120,"context_line":"            - keys:"},{"line_number":121,"context_line":"                tripleo::neutron_ovs_agent::firewall_rules: tripleo::neutron_ovs_dpdk_agent::firewall_rules"},{"line_number":122,"context_line":"          - neutron::agents::ml2::ovs::enable_dpdk: true"},{"line_number":123,"context_line":"          - get_attr: [Ovs, role_data, config_settings]"},{"line_number":124,"context_line":"          - get_attr: [RoleParametersValue, value]"}],"source_content_type":"text/x-yaml","patch_set":25,"id":"3fa7e38b_ead6754f","side":"PARENT","line":121,"updated":"2019-11-14 21:15:48.000000000","message":"I\u0027m not sure what exactly this is doing but is this covered in this coversion?","commit_id":"def359fd3056a27318e91f00c6322704b0319684"}]}
